2 El imperfecto The imperfect tense There is more than one past tense in Spanish. The preterite tense is for completed, simple actions in the past (I ate). The imperfect tense is for continuous actions in the past (I was eating).

3 English usage… A) Was/were..ing While I was/we were working in the factory B) Used to Every day I used to … C) Would Every morning I would visit my grandpa

4 Examples of the Imperfect 1. Description or state I was wearing a blue dress. 2. Repetition or habit I used to get up at 7 every day.

5 3. Interrupted action We were eating when they arrived While he was acting he fell down 4. Simultaneous, incomplete actions While I was speaking, he was reading a book.
